Cellular Automaton PlanterThis planter or vase is a 1D cellular automaton, fully parametric and intended for 3D printing. I've included a few models that I thought were interesting, two are pictured, printed at 75% scale, but the full size models are 120mm diameter and 100mm high. These models include:Rule 110, capable of universal computationRule 30, which shows chaotic and aperiodic behaviourFeel free to ask for any others you may want if you don't want to generate them yourself. Would also love to hear suggestions for variations or similar models. There are a couple more models on Printables here, but I'm limited by file sizes on Maker World so cannot add them here.Printing infoI printed the models at 0.2mm layer height with a 0.4mm nozzle, and it looks great in bicolour silk PLA.
